About Madison School

Madison School is a public school in Wyandotte, MI, part of Wyandotte School District of the City of. Madison School serves approximately 158 students, and covers grades Pre-K-12th, and has a 5.4:1 student-teacher ratio. Madison School has a current MySchoolScout rating of 7.7 out of 10 and ranks #555 of 3,192 schools in MI.

Structured state assessment records for Madison School show 58%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022) and 64%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).

What Parents Should Know

At 158 students, Madison School is on the smaller side. That usually buys more individual attention and teachers who know every kid by name, with the trade-off of fewer electives and extracurriculars than a larger school can staff. Ask what activities it actually offers.

At 5.4:1 students to teachers, Madison School sits well below the national average. Smaller classes like that usually mean more one-on-one time between students and teachers.

58% of students at Madison School were chronically absent in the 2022-23 school year, above the national average. Chronic absenteeism means missing 15 or more school days, and at high rates it drags on classroom pacing for everyone. Ask what the school does to help families get kids to class consistently.
